Everett, USA Weather Averages

August is the hottest month in Everett with an average temperature of 17°C (62°F) and the coldest is December at 6°C (43°F) with the most daily sunshine hours at 13 in July. The wettest month is March with an average of 80.7mm of rain. The best month to swim in the sea is in August when the average sea temperature is 14°C (56°F).

Average Daily Sunshine Hours Everett

What are Average Daily Sunshine Hours?
Total sunshine hours for the month, divided by the number of days in the month. Sunshine hours are taken with a sunshine recorder, either a Campbell-Stokes recorder or an Eppley Pyreheliometer

Average Sea Temperature Everett

What is Average Sea Temperature?
Average daily sea temperatures and divided by the number of days in the month. Sea Temperatures are taken from buoys, ships and even satellites can calculate sea temperature based on energy that is radiated from the sea's surface
